10 Simple Techniques For E2 Visa Table of ContentsThe Only Guide to E2 VisaSee This Report on E2 VisaHow E2 Visa can Save You Time, Stress, and Money.Before starting your business, totally research local markets. Keeping complete financial documents and paperwork is important for e2 visa renewal in the U.S.A.., https://immigration-lawyer81664.myparisblog.com/37337621/e2-visa-process